Gulf Shores 9-0 After Demolishing Vigor

News Staff • October 28, 2023

Just one game away from undefeated regular season

Gulf Shores Football News

The Gulf Shores Dolphins jumped out to an early start by scoring 21 points in the first quarter against Vigor and never looked back. The duo of Wilson and Royal kept the offense rolling, while the defense stopped the typically fast scoring offense of Vigor.


In the first quarter Gulf Shores fans may have worried after the Vigor Wolves answered the an early touchdown. That only seemed to make the Dolphins defense more intense for the remainder of the half. The Phin's defense actually held Vigor's explosive star (RB) Benjamin to just over 50 yards.


The game was full of exciting plays from both sides of the ball and in every quarter. Gulf Shores had several long runs and passes, seemingly in-charge of 3rd downs on each drive. Each time Vigor made an error, the Dolphins Defense were quick to take advantage.


In a week of turmoil related to an story published by a local news station concerning ASHAA infractions, the chaos did not seem to disturb the players. An attorney for the Gulf Shores City School system has responded to the allegations and denied any wrongdoing.


The Gulf Shores Dolphins are just one win away from having a undefeated regular season. Their next game is against the Rain Red Raiders (6-2), on November 3rd. The game will be played in Gulf Shores.

Gulf Shores Tax News
By News Staff February 20, 2025
Alabama's 14th annual Severe Weather Preparedness Sales Tax Holiday is set for Friday, February 21, through Sunday, February 23, 2025. During this period, residents can purchase essential severe weather preparedness items without paying the state's 4% sales tax. In some areas, local taxes will also be waived, allowing shoppers to save up to 10% on eligible items.
Gulf Shores Golf News
By News Staff February 20, 2025
Gulf Shores Golf Club in Alabama has appointed Grant Cole as its new head superintendent. Cole, a Class A Superintendent, previously led Braelinn Golf Club in Peachtree City, Georgia, and has extensive experience in course restoration and southeastern agronomic practices.
